Barren Landscapes

Please join us for our first event of the 2017–18 academic year: Opening Panel: Barren Landscapes and Open Spaces. How do our views of land and landscape influence our religious imagination, and vice versa?

The panelists are: Kimberley C. Patton, Professor of the Comparative and Historical Study of Religion; Matthew L. Potts, Associate Professor of Religion and Literature and of Ministry Studies; Charles M. Stang, Professor of Early Christian Thought, Director of the Center for the Study of World Religions; and Terry Tempest Williams, Writer-in-Residence.
